我试图从数据库中的表中删除所有记录,但我无法删除.有谁能够帮我?
我正在使用此链接删除
public void delete()
{
String DELETEPASSCODE_DETAIL = "DELETE * FROM Payment;";
db.execSQL(DELETEPASSCODE_DETAIL);
}
Run Code Online (Sandbox Code Playgroud)
我在这里调用删除功能
private void savepay() {
// TODO Auto-generated method stub
try{
String check;
webService calService=new webService();
dh.open();
Cursor c = dh.pay();
Toast.makeText(getBaseContext(),className+c.getString(1)+c.getString(2)+c.getString(3)+c.getString(4),Toast.LENGTH_LONG).show();
check= calService.paymentReceipt("PaymentReceipt",c.getString(1),c.getString(2),c.getString(3),c.getString(4),c.getString(5),"0");
}
while (c.moveToNext());
dh.delete();//here i called delete function
dh.close();
}
Run Code Online (Sandbox Code Playgroud)
你的代码应该是这样的
public void delete()
{
String DELETEPASSCODE_DETAIL = "DELETE FROM Payment;";
db.execSQL(DELETEPASSCODE_DETAIL);
}
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
3099 次 |
| 最近记录: |